As far as my ears are concerned, yesterday was the first major multi-album new music release day of 2010, so it’s past time for my annual list of what I’m looking forward to in the months ahead. I’ve included albums with solid dates, some with ballpark estimates, a few that are mere whispers on the wind. Oh, and a couple of pure fantasies. A boy can dream, can’t he?

Keep in mind, this is not even close to a comprehensive rundown of what’s supposed to be coming out – just the stuff I have high hopes for. If it’s not on here, I’m either apathetic at best or totally unaware.
